ENV BIOL 3121 - Concepts in Ecology III

Career: Undergraduate
Units: 3
Term: Semester 1
Campus: North Terrace
Contact: Up to 5 hours per week, plus field trip
Available for Study Abroad and Exchange: Yes
Available for Non-Award Study: No
Assumed Knowledge: ENV BIOL 2502
Assessment: Exam, practical assignments
Syllabus:

This course addresses advanced ecological concepts, building upon Ecology II, and providing a common anchor to other Ecology courses in Year III. It deals with populations, communities and ecosystems, and examines various approaches to their studies, including experiments and models. Students are provided with both an understanding of theoretical ecology as well as a foundation for ecological applications. Details of the 4 day compulsory field trip communicated at start of the course.
